The ingredients needed to make Tempura and Ginger Soy Sauce:
- Prepare Tempura batter
- Prepare 3/4 cup plain flour
- Take 1 egg
- Take 1 cup ice cold sparkling water
- Take 1/4 tsp bicarbonate of soda
- Take Ground nut oil or Sunflower oil, for frying
- Get 1 pinch sea salt
- Make ready Dipping Sauce
- Prepare 12 tbsp rice wine vinegar
- Prepare 2 tbsp light soy sauce
- Get 4 tbsp sugar
- Get 2 tsp grated fresh ginger

Instructions to make Tempura and Ginger Soy Sauce:
- Mix the sauce ingredients all together in a bowl and set aside until needed.
- Beat the egg with the icy cold water until light and fluffy.
- Add the flour and bicarbonate of soda to the egg mixture. Mix quickly but do not over-beat.
- While preparing the vegetables and meat, store the batter in the fridge.
- You can use the tempura batter to coat most fish, seafood, meat or vegetables.
- Cut your selected vegetables, fish or meat into bite sized pieces, a little larger than pop corn.
- Make sure the pieces are dry before coating in batter. Coat pieces with a small amount of flour if needs be.
- When ready to cook heat the deep fat fryer, coat the pieces with the batter and carefully drop straight into the oil as you go along.
- Fry for 3-5 minutes. Once batter is golden brown remove from fryer and place cooked pieces on kitchen roll.
- Sprinkle with a pinch of salt as soon as removed from fryer.
- Serve with the dipping sauce.
